Express Message Service

The international price war for crude oil has just intensified. Joe Biden and the US government have decided to take on the Saudis to cut oil production, and the G7 bloc of advanced countries is pushing for a price cap on Russian crude.

India, an importer of 85% of its crude oil needs, has been playing a balancing game but is now caught in the crossfire. With Brent crude oil prices expected to surpass $100 a barrel,…

Source link